The Manufacturers Life Insurance Company grew its stake in shares of BCE, Inc. (NYSE:BCE – Free Report) (TSE:BCE) by 21.7% during the 1st quarter, HoldingsChannel reports. The institutional investor owned 5,038,362 shares of the utilities provider’s stock after acquiring an additional 897,141 shares during the period. The Manufacturers Life Insurance Company’s holdings in BCE were worth $127,011,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

BCE (NYSE:BCE – Get Free Report) (TSE:BCE)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, May 7th. The utilities provider reported $0.46 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.42 by $0.04. BCE had a return on equity of 13.87% and a net margin of 25.66%.The firm had revenue of $4.43 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$4.38 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company posted $0.69 earnings per share. The company’s revenue was up 4.0% compared to the same quarter last year. BCE has set its FY 2026 guidance at 1.790-1.910 EPS. As a group, research analysts expect that BCE, Inc. will post 1.85 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

About BCE
BCE Inc (NYSE: BCE) is a Canadian communications, media and entertainment company that operates through its primary subsidiaries, including Bell Canada and Bell Media. As a large integrated telecommunications provider, BCE delivers a broad range of connectivity services and content to residential, business and wholesale customers across Canada. The company combines network infrastructure with media assets to offer bundled communications and entertainment solutions.
On the services side, BCE provides fixed-line and wireless voice services, mobile data, high-speed internet, fibre and broadband access, and television services through platforms such as Bell Fibe and Bell TV.
